> Hi Chris,
> in my past experience you have to fix more things to update
> emacs-for-clojure to latest stable CIDER release (I'm currently using
> emacs-prelude instead):
>
> In your init.el
>
> (add-to-list 'package-archives
> '("melpa-stable" . "http://stable.melpa.org/packages/") t)
> (add-to-list 'package-pinned-packages
> '(cider . "melpa-stable") t)
> (add-to-list 'package-pinned-packages
> '(seq . "melpa-stable") t)
> (add-to-list 'package-pinned-packages
> '(clojure-mode . "melpa-stable") t)
>
> And in your customizations/setup-clojure.el you have to fix the minibuffer
> documentaion as follows:
>
>
> (add-hook 'cider-mode-hook 'eldoc-mode)

>> I spent the last week learning and using Emacs and CIDER for Clojure
>> Development.
>>
>> I've started to write up a lot of the lessons I've learned from doing so
>> in the hopes that it will help some other people who attempt something
>> similar.
>>
>> Anyway, if you're interested in getting started with Emacs and CIDER,
>> you'll have to learn about how to use the keyboard so I wrote a couple of
>> key lessons in a Medium post: Developing in Clojure with Emacs:
>> Mastering the Keyboard
>> <https://medium.com/@chris.shellenbarger/developing-in-clojure-with-emacs-mastering-the-keyboard-6cb9bef7f760>
>> .
>>
>> My environment was Emacs 24.5.1 with CIDER 0.16.0 on Linux Mint 18.3.
>>
>> I used the Clojure for the Brave and True <https://www.braveclojure.co> book
>> for a basic intro into Emacs <https://www.braveclojure.com/basic-emacs/> and
>> used the provided emacs configuration files as a starting point. However,
>> these only worked with CIDER 0.8.0 and were about four years old. I made
>> some modifications of the files to work with CIDER 0.16.0 and put them up
>> for anyone to use on my BitBucket Repository
>> <https://bitbucket.org/64BitChris/linux-emacs-configuration>.
>>
>> I have a lot more to share about my Emacs experience, but I found that
>> there was so much that I had to split it into multiple posts.
>>
>> Hope it helps someone out there!
